**Q: I heard jobs were firing late last month — is that still a thing?**

Mostly fixed. The Brindlehop cron drift turned out to be clock skew on two scheduler nodes after an NTP config change. We corrected it, but a few nightly jobs still wobble by a minute or so. If you see drift over five minutes, flag it. The investigation write-up and current status live on the page below.

wiki page, tahaf-tajog: https://jira.ordindyn.corp/pipeline

Ticket: Incremental rebuild gaps on Pagewright sites. Support has confirmed that when editors publish two changes within thirty seconds, the second change is sometimes dropped from the incremental static rebuild queue, leaving stale pages until the nightly full build. We propose shortening the debounce window and adding a reconciliation pass. Please review the attached plan carefully before deployment. Sign-off is required from the person named below.

account owner for fajep-yagef: Kasix Eliiel

Step 6: Bloom filter config. Siftgate sits in front of the Kestrel KV store and rejects known-absent keys. Set BLOOM_BITS=26 and HASH_COUNT=7 in /etc/siftgate/filter.env. Restart is required after changes. Siftgate also authenticates to Kestrel for filter rebuilds; add that credential as the next line in the env file.

secret setting of yagef-baweg: RELAY_SECRET29=cb53deb59a49ed54d9f43599b54ca

**Vendor note: Inkmill markdown pipeline**

Rendering for Parchway docs is outsourced to Inkmill under an annual contract, renewing each March. They handle sanitization and PDF export; we own the upload queue. SLA: 4-hour response on rendering failures. Escalate only after two failed retries. Their support desk is reachable at the address below.

billing contact of hahaf-baguf = zorael.tammir.jorius@sivrelhq.internal